Fare Information
The Friendly Bus rides are available on a donation basis. A $2.00 donation per trip is suggested.

City Express fares are $1.00 a ride; discount tickets are available.

Para Express rides are $2.00.

Tickets can be purchased on any City Express vehicle or at the Transportation Office of Home Healthcare, Hospice and Community Services.

(Home Healthcare, Hospice and Community Services)REQUEST FOR PROPOSALS COMPUTER HARDWARE and Related Equipment  The VNA at HCS is soliciting proposals for computer hardware and related equipment for to support applications for their transportation program located at 312 Marlboro Street in Keene, NH. The specifications for this service are to include all labor costs as well as material and shipping costs. The specifications are as follows: 

1.       General Requirements1.1.    Itemized cost proposal to include a list of all expenses, i.e. delivery costs.1.2.    Minimum of two (2) client references  

2.       Hardware specifications  (2) Six Core 64bit  Processors at least 2.5GHz 12M Cache, (8) 2.5” SAS bays, DVDRW, Dual Gigabit NICs  Minimum 48GB of PC3-10600 240 Pin DDR3 SDRAM(8) 146GB SAS 6Gb/s 15K RPM Drives3 Year 24/7  4 Hour hardware support(1) License for Symantec Backup Exec System Recovery (1) SQL 2008 License with (5) CAL’s(1) Symantec Backup Exec SQL Agent License (1) Rack mountable UPS capable of running(1) Network Monitoring for UPS unit 2400 Watts/3000 VA or higher(1) License of Windows 2008 Server (standard)                                        

1.       Warranty Requirements 

1.1.    Hardware shall carry a warranty with documented terms and conditions that is effective for no less than 3 calendar years from the date of purchase and shall be the sole responsibility of the seller to administrate any claims made by the buyer against the seller and /or OEM during the warranty term. Any costs such as, but not limited to, shipping, restocking or administrative fees associated with a warranty claim shall be at the sellers’ expense. Seller shall provide warranty services for all material and workmanship for 3 calendar years from the date     invoice is paid for installation services and hardware.

1.2  Warranty Services are to include any and all time, labor, materials and or fees involved in resolving issues that arise from equipment failures or buyer warranty claims.                         

3.       Specification Compliance

3.1.    The specifications indicated in this bid invitation will be considered the minimum requirements. Bidder’s offer must meet or exceed these minimum requirements. 

3.2.    All equipment and components offered by the bidder must be new: shall not be used, rebuilt, refurbished; shall not have been used as demonstration equipment, and shall not have been placed anywhere for evaluation purposes.

Proposals should not exceed 2 pages. 

Following an initial assessment of the proposals submitted, qualified firms may be invited to attend oral interviews prior to final selection.  Qualified firms must have a DUNS number and be registered in Central Contractor Registration (www.ccr.gov).  

The proposal process shall be in accordance with the procurement procedures for grantees and contractors set forth in the Federal Transit Administration Master Agreement.  The Transportation program of  the VNA at HCS reserves the right to reject any and all proposals, as well as the right to accept other than the lowest cost proposal. 

A fixed price contract will be executed with the selected firm.  The contract will include scope of services, terms of compensation, reporting requirements, performance period, termination provision, and general contract provisions, including, but not limited to, insurance and indemnification requirements.  It is anticipated that the award will be made by 4pm on November 18, 2011 and delivery of hardware and related equipment will be not later than  December 1, 2010 or at a mutually agreeable time shortly thereafter.  The completion date for this project will be 10 days after the start of the project.
